We Now Know

Gaddis, John Lewis (Robert Lovett Professor of History, Robert Lovett Professor of History, Yale University)
We Now Know
Based on the latest findings of Cold War historians and extensive research in American archives as well as the recently opened archives in Eastern Europe, the former Soviet Union, and China, this book provides a vividly written, eye-opening account of the Cold War during the years from the end of World War II to its most dangerous moment, the Cuban missile crisis.

George F. Kennan

Gaddis, John Lewis
George F. Kennan
The full scope of George Kennan's long life and vast influence is revealed by one of today's most important Cold War scholars. Yale historian Gaddis began this magisterial history almost 30 years ago, the result is a remarkably revealing view of a great Cold War strategist.

Strategies of Containment

Gaddis, John Lewis
Strategies of Containment
A must read for anyone interested in Cold War history, this updated edition shows how President Ronald Reagan completed the decades-long process of the containment of communism, thereby bringing the Cold War to an end. 3 maps.
